Apparently, I didn't read the rules carefully enough because as of today I am no longer allowed to post on the eBay discussion boards.
Yesterday I received the following notice from eBay:
Hello rksmythe,
Recently we became aware that your eBay registered account was involved in the following activity:
Discussion or reposting of deleted posts, warning letters, or discussion of sanctioned or no longer registered members, which is not permitted at eBay.

The outside links issue is something that needs to be addressed by eBay. As they appear to be morphing into a shopping portal rather than a destination. I don't think it will be addressed but it certainly needs to be. Sellers should be able to promote their outside eBay business in light of the reduced visibility in stores. Regardless, once you have a customer you can communicate with them and let them know you have another site. (Make sure to have their permission if using direct email) We used to have 5 emails got out to the customer on every order. That is 5 legitimate contacts to let them know to buy their next item on your website. If you have a webstore, start treating eBay as a customer acquisition tool. Acquire the customer on eBay give them incentives to do future business on your website.

We realize that you may not have been aware there was a rule against this activity. Therefore, we would like to take this opportunity to invite you to review our site policies, which can be found at: http://pages.ebay.com/help/policies/everyone-boards.html
Please understand our goal is to help you understand our policies to ensure successful experiences at eBay. Therefore, we respectfully request that you refrain from this activity in the future to avoid the possibility of a suspension of your eBay registration.
Well, based on my post I can see why they didn't want me making those types of comments on their message boards, and I would have refrained from doing thatin the future if I actually had the chance. Not more than 12 minutes later I received an additional email from eBay:
Hello rksmythe,
Recently [12 minutes ago] we became aware that your eBay registered account was involved in the following activity:
* Public Board Abuse:
Refusing to follow eBay staff instruction, which is not permitted at eBay. You have previously been warned [12 minutes ago] for inappropriate board activities, and asked to review our Board Usage Policies.
Therefore, we are revoking all privileges of posting on any eBay board or groups, for an indefinite period of time. During this time you may continue to bid and to list your auctions. Please note that any violation of this sanction, by using an alternate ID to post on any eBay board, or to report posts for violations will result in the suspension of your eBay account, including all buying and selling privileges.
Okay, so when I registered my name I thought this might happen but what amazed me is the selective enforcement. I have been reading the message boards for eight months straight and every rule that I supposedly broke is broken on a daily basis, and those posters are still free to post their comments.
